2009 Supreme(Pat) 1466

NAVIN SINHA
Ram Balak Ram S/o Late Buchchun Ram – Appellant
Versus
State Of Bihar Through The Chief Secretary Government Of Bihar – Respondent


JUDGEMENT

1. Heard learned counsel for the petitioners and learned counsel for the State.

2. The petitioners were appointed initially on daily wages on different dates in between 1980 to 1982. They were brought into the work charge establishment in February, 1988. In April, 2002 they were sought to be reverted to their status of daily wage. They came to this Court in CWJC Nos. 6293 of 2002 and 6760 of 2002. The writ applications came to be disposed with a large batch of analogous cases giving directions to consider for regularization in accordance with inter alia the judgment of the Supreme Court in Secretary, State of Karnataka & Ors. vs. Uma Devi & Ors., (2006)4 SCC 1 [:2006(2) PLJR (SC)363]. They have now been directed to be regularized by an order dated 28.11.2006 and given fresh posting, in pursuance of which formal orders with regard to them have been issued on 29.11.2006.
